#!/usr/bin/env python3 import sys def generate_pci_data(): vendors = [] devices = [] classes = [] current_vendor = None in_class_section = False for line in sys.stdin: if not line.strip() or line.startswith('#'): continue if line.startswith('C '): in_class_section = True parts = line.split() class_id = parts[1] name = " ".join(parts[2:]).replace('"', '\\"') classes.append((class_id, "00", name)) current_class = class_id continue if not in_class_section: if not line.startswith('\t'): parts = line.split() if len(parts) < 2: continue current_vendor = parts[0] name = " ".join(parts[1:]).replace('"', '\\"') vendors.append((current_vendor, name)) elif line.startswith('\t') and not line.startswith('\t\t'): parts = line.strip().split() if len(parts) < 2: continue dev_id = parts[0] name = " ".join(parts[1:]).replace('"', '\\"') devices.append((current_vendor, dev_id, name)) else: if line.startswith('\t') and not line.startswith('\t\t'): parts = line.strip().split() sub_id = parts[0] name = " ".join(parts[1:]).replace('"', '\\"') classes.append((current_class, sub_id, name)) print("#include \n") print("#include \n") print("const struct pci_vendor pci_vendors[] = {") for v_id, name in vendors: print(f" {{0x{v_id}, \"{name}\"}},") print(" {0xFFFF, 0}\n};\n") print("const struct pci_device_id pci_device_names[] = {") for v_id, d_id, name in devices: print(f" {{0x{v_id}, 0x{d_id}, \"{name}\"}},") print(" {0xFFFF, 0xFFFF, 0}\n};\n") print("const struct pci_class pci_classes[] = {") for c_id, s_id, name in classes: print(f" {{0x{c_id}, 0x{s_id}, \"{name}\"}},") print(" {0xFF, 0xFF, 0}\n};") if __name__ == "__main__": generate_pci_data()
